This residence explores the relationship between new and existing architecture in Philadelphia’s historic Rittenhouse neighborhood. The central, vertical window delineates the front of the Rittenhouse house into two halves, referencing the double nature of the site’s past.

Tiny Tower Residence places a 1250 SF home on a 12’ by 29’ lot, whose similarly scaled neighbors are currently used as single-car parking and rear yards for the adjacent houses.
